💡 Every transaction in Douano receives a unique transaction number. This transaction number always consists of a prefix followed by a sequence number.
⇢ Go to Settings - General - Transaction numberings
💡 In Douano, each transaction has a default prefix configured. This default prefix can be modified.
💡 To adjust the prefix and/or sequence number of a transaction, click on the line of that transaction.
Prefix: the letters used to identify transactions of the selected type.
Last number: here you can manually set the last number of the selected transaction type. For example, if you enter 100, Douano will assign 101 as the sequence number for the next transaction of this type.
